Output 41cd01cb8ebab24f63dfa5b94fcfd6c496fe63e7ed6439ac00b61cd1b0da796e:6

value
105666383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 472d49c0b361d51af6507cc26cf619180193b677 OP_EQUAL
address
MEPWTiqxWyY8qqFPwgrMDH5fhrqWYU6JD9
transaction
41cd01cb8ebab24f63dfa5b94fcfd6c496fe63e7ed6439ac00b61cd1b0da796e
spent
true